Borderline Personality Disorder therapists in Simpsonville, South Carolina Statistics

Borderline Personality Disorder therapists in Simpsonville, South Carolina average 15 years of experience and charge around $224 per session. 100% offer online sessions. The top treatment approaches are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) (76%), Dialectical Behavior Therapy (DBT) (62%), and Behavioral Therapy (43%).
